Symptoms of Infection
Symptoms of a malware infection can vary widely but often include slow system performance, frequent crashes, unwanted pop-ups, and changes to your browser settings or homepage. You might also notice that your computer is behaving erratically, such as launching programs on its own or displaying unusual error messages. Sometimes, infections can be stealthy, and you might not notice any symptoms at all, which is why regular scans with antivirus software are crucial for detecting and removing threats like Nicegfclub.com.
- Unexplained changes to your browser or system settings.
- Appearance of unwanted programs or toolbars.
- Slowdown of your computer's performance.
- Frequent system crashes or freezes.
- Pop-ups or advertisements appearing without your interaction.
How to Remove Nicegfclub.com
- Enter Safe Mode with Networking to prevent the malware from interfering with the removal process. This mode allows you to access the internet while limiting the malware's ability to run.
- Perform a full scan of your system using a reputable antivirus tool, such as SpyHunter. Ensure the tool is updated to the latest version to increase the chances of detecting and removing the malware successfully.
- Uninstall suspicious programs that you do not recognize or that were installed around the time the malware was detected. Be cautious and only remove programs you are sure are not necessary for your system's operation.
- Reset your browsers (Chrome, Firefox, Edge, etc.) to their default settings. This can help remove any malicious extensions or settings changes made by the malware.
- Reboot your computer and perform another scan to ensure the malware has been completely removed. This step is crucial as some malware can only be fully removed after a system restart.
